Toyoda Minoru’s “Draw This and Die” has been decided to be made into a TV anime. It will be broadcast on Nippon Television.

“Draw This and Die” is a “manga romantic growth story” that depicts the struggles of a high school girl, Yasumi Ai, who is fascinated by manga, forming a manga study group with her friends and searching for what she wants to draw. It won the “Manga Taisho 2023” grand prize and the 70th Shogakukan Manga Award. It is being serialized in Gessan (Shogakukan), and the latest volume, 7, will be released on April 11th.

Also, the teaser visual for the anime and a comment from Toyoda have arrived. The teaser visual captures the back of the main character, Ai, who lives in ” Izu Ojima, “modeled after Toyoda’s hometown, Izu Oshima, and Pokota, who is by her side. Further details on the anime will be available in the future.

Comment from Toyoda Minoru: It’s being made into an anime!!! When I was asked, “What do you want me to pay attention to?” during my first meeting with the production team, I thought I would say, “I want you to think about the island’s beauty first.” Just as I requested, the pictures of the island that I was shown in the check were so beautiful.
I’m looking forward to seeing the girls moving freely in this space.
I’m looking forward to it with excitement, along with everyone else.
